Understanding Essential Resource Management Concepts
Resource management serves as the cornerstone of successful tower defense strategy gameplay, demanding players to balance urgent defensive requirements against long-term economic growth. Every currency unit spent on towers represents an opportunity cost—early resource investments provide quick defense but limit future expansion potential. The essential factor is understanding your game’s economy curve: how resources generate over time, whether through steady generation, enemy defeats, or interest mechanics. Smart players identify the lowest defense requirement required to survive each round while maximizing investments in economy-boosting structures or upgrades that compound returns throughout the match.
Managing your spending wisely distinguishes capable strategists from masters of the genre. Opening stages typically feature less powerful foes, creating opportunities to commit significant funds in resource generation rather than costly defense structures. This measured approach creates financial benefits that develop into dominant protective strength during later, more challenging stages. However, misjudging enemy strength or delaying critical defenses can lead to devastating failures that erase financial benefits. Effective budget control requires ongoing assessment of approaching dangers, current defensive coverage, and current budget to choose wisely about when to preserve, deploy, or redistribute funds.
Understanding how resources are used efficiently helps optimize all purchase decisions throughout your defensive approach. Calculate damage-per-cost ratios for various tower options, factoring in firing rate, range, and unique powers exploiting enemy weaknesses. Some towers offer exceptional value against particular foes but deplete reserves against others, making adaptable units often more economical for overall protection. Track your resource output and project future income to plan major purchases or upgrades several waves ahead. This forward-thinking approach prevents reactive spending that exhausts funds in crucial situations, guaranteeing you preserve financial stability while adjusting to increasing challenges.

Bottleneck Management and Path Optimization
Chokepoints represent the most valuable real estate in tower defense maps, channeling hostile units into narrow passages where your towers inflict maximum damage. These inherent chokepoints—whether designed into the map or created through strategic blocking—require adversaries to expend more duration in combat, substantially boosting your damage output per resource invested. Identifying and fortifying these vital areas from the start forms the groundwork for your overall defense plan. Place your strongest damage towers at chokepoints to remove key threats, while backup troops provide crowd control and debuffs that amplify overall effectiveness.
Path manipulation goes further than exploiting existing chokepoints to strategically establishing them through tower placement. Many tower defense games allow you to control how enemies move by strategically positioning towers as obstacles, forcing opponents to take longer routes through your defenses. This path design strategy maximizes the time enemies spend within your firing range, effectively multiplying your defensive potential without additional towers. However, balance creativity with practicality—overly complex mazes can backfire if they stretch your defenses across too many areas or create unintended vulnerabilities. Test path modifications carefully to ensure they strengthen rather than compromise your defensive integrity.

Core Tower Types and Their Combinations
Understanding the core tower categories forms the backbone of effective gaming tower defense gameplay. Most tower defense games offer different tower classes, each created to counter particular enemy types or fulfill designated tactical roles. Offensive towers offer raw combat power, speed-reduction towers control enemy travel speed, splash-damage towers address grouped threats, defensive-enhancement towers strengthen nearby defenses, economic towers produce additional resources, and advanced towers target particular vulnerabilities. Recognizing these categories and their designed purposes allows players to construct balanced defensive networks that handle multiple threat scenarios at once while improving the effectiveness of restricted placement opportunities.
- Damage towers eliminate key threats rapidly with concentrated single-target firepower and precision
- Slowing towers decrease unit velocity dramatically, prolonging vulnerability for every defense structure
- Area-of-effect towers perform well against grouped enemies, dealing splash damage to multiple units
- Support towers enhance adjacent tower performance through buffs, range extensions, or damage
- Economic towers generate passive income streams, accelerating mid-game and late-game scaling potential
- Tactical towers oppose armored, flying, or regenerating enemies with specific damage categories
Tower synergies amplify defensive effectiveness significantly when strategically arranged within your gaming tower defense strategy gameplay approach. Combining slowing towers with high-damage units boosts overall damage by holding foes in firing distance. AoE towers placed behind slow towers destroy clustered enemies. Support units should control strategic bottlenecks, boosting several offensive units at once to establish areas of intense damage. Resource towers positioned in initial secure areas speed up resource production, enabling powerful defensive upgrades before challenging enemy waves hit. Recognizing these cooperative dynamics changes individual defenses into integrated systems, where each element enhances others to create defensive capabilities far exceeding their individual contributions.
Economic Equilibrium Among Upgrading and Expanding
One of the most critical decisions in gaming tower defense strategy play requires determining when to upgrade existing towers versus building new ones. Improving increases a tower’s damage, attack range, or unique powers, rendering it efficient against harder opponents. However, expanding your defensive protection by adding more towers offers broader map control and prevents enemies from slipping through gaps. The ideal method is based on your existing position: early game generally supports expansion to secure critical pathways, while mid-to-late game gains from strategic upgrades that maximize damage output against growing stronger foes.
Calculating cost-effectiveness informs these determinations successfully. Evaluate the cost efficiency per damage point of upgrading versus constructing new units, accounting for factors like firing rate, area of effect, and enemy types moving in. If doubling upgrades a tower’s effectiveness for a fraction of the expense of a additional tower, upgrading becomes more cost-effective. Conversely, if enemies are bypassing your defensive structures fully, expansion takes priority independent of upgrade gains. Experienced players preserve versatility, holding resources in reserve ready to address to unexpected waves while gradually strengthening their primary defenses through strategic improvements that support their overall strategic layout.
